Output 5cbbf3c0ef90e580571e89e6f9ca611c52798a0e218ef935f242339aabfe88b7:59

value
106448
script pubkey
OP_0 OP_PUSHBYTES_20 c58314275affc4a8773f93bef7fd1710e5f1f963
address
bc1qckp3gf66llz2saeljwl00lghzrjlr7tr5kq9vd
transaction
5cbbf3c0ef90e580571e89e6f9ca611c52798a0e218ef935f242339aabfe88b7
confirmations
93800
spent
true